19th Century Philosophy: Friedrich Nietzsche (1844-1900)

B. God is Dead We have Killed him – you and I!” (From The Joyful Wisdom) Nietzsche he asserts that we have lowered the noble concept of God to mediocrity and have thereby slain the idea of God. As regards Nietzsche’s atheism,

“It is a mater of course with me, from instinct, I am too inquisitive, too questionable, too exuberant to stand for any gross answer. God is a gross answer, an indelicacy upon us thinkers—at bottom merely a gross prohibition for us; you shall not think.” (Twilight of the Idols, ch. I, 1)
